Current Jury Instruction: [none] Proposed Revised Jury Instruction: The defendant unlawfully killed the deceased
if the defendant killed the deceased without a legally valid justification or excuse. Relevant Cases: 1. If not unlawful, an act does not amount to a crime. State v. Lawson, 128 W. Va. 136, 36 S.E. 2d 26 (1945).
